public async Task <ActionResult <Interesse> > Post(Interesse interesse) { try{ interesse.StatusCompra = true; var interesseRegistrado = await repositorio.Post(interesse); //Manda cadastrar nformação no BD através do respositório Usuario usuarioRetornado = context.Usuario.Where(u => u.IdUsuario == interesseRegistrado.IdUsuario).FirstOrDefault(); string titulo = "Parabéns pela escolha!"; string corpo = "Seu interesse foi registrado em nosso banco de dados. Aguarde o contato de nosso Administrador para adquirir o produto escolhido!"; emailUtils.EnvioEmail(usuarioRetornado.Email, titulo, corpo); return(interesseRegistrado); } catch (System.Exception ex) { // E se houver erro ele mostra qual foi return(BadRequest(new{ mensagem = "Erro" + ex.Message })); //BadRequest Mostra o erro, Mensagem (var) mostra qual foi recebendo o erro da exceção } }